Musashi was a legend of his time. His favored weapon was a wooden sword, and he rarely fought with a real one. He defeated his opponents through cunning, or by turning their own strength against them. Having reached the height of his power, he began to evolve artistically and spiritually, becoming one of the most skilled painters and calligraphers in the country while intensifying his practice of Zen. He was able to channel his martial skills into a search for something deeper. Musashi always remained a solitary traveler, shunning the power, wealth, and comfort that would come from a steady employment in the service of a feudal lord, preferring instead a constant and tireless pursuit of truth, perfection, and the true Way. He eventually came to understand that perfection in an art, whether of peace or war, allowed one to attain deeper spiritual understanding. His philosophy, along with his martial strategies, is concentrated in his celebrated work, The Book of Five Rings, written towards the end of his life. After graduating with degrees in Political Science and Japanese Language and Literature, he began a series of in-depth studies on the philosophy of the Edo period (1603–1868) at Aichi Prefectural University in Nagoya, Japan. He has translated from Japanese into English the Hagakure, The Book of Five Rings, The Sword of Life, The Immutable Mind, Eiji Yoshikawa's novel Taiko, and Ideals of the Samurai, used as a college textbook in Japanese history and culture courses.
